Native Reserve Dispensaries in New Brunswick

New Brunswick is home to Indigenous communities with established cannabis retail operations. The most active reserves include Devon (9 stores), Tobique (6 stores), and Richibucto (4 stores). These rez dispensaries operate under the sovereignty of their respective communities and offer a range of cannabis products to visitors and community members alike.

Are reserve dispensaries legal in New Brunswick?

Cannabis dispensaries on First Nations reserves in New Brunswick operate under Indigenous community governance and First Nations jurisdiction. These stores serve both community members and visitors from surrounding areas. Always respect store policies and community guidelines when visiting.

What is rez weed?

"Rez weed" refers to cannabis sold at dispensaries on First Nations reserves and Native American reservations. These native-owned weed stores often carry flower, pre-rolls, edibles, concentrates, and accessories. Prices and product availability vary by store — see individual listings for details.
